Clinical Assessment of Pediatric Patients with Differentiated Thyroid Carcinoma: A 30-Year Experience at a Single Institution
Topic overview
Retrospective analysis of 94 pediatric DTC patients over 30 years identifies tumor size >2cm and lymph node involvement as key recurrence predictors. While total thyroidectomy remains standard, lobectomy may be appropriate for limited disease (<2cm, intrathyroidal, unifocal, node-negative cases).
